FM
indoor
antenna
(included)
This
antenna
is
normally
sufficient
for
reception
of
FM
broadcasts.
FM
Indoor
antenna
(included)
Attach
to
a
wail
(using
a
tack
or
tape)
facing
in
the
direction
of
best
reception.
For
best
reception
sound
quality
An
FM
outdoor
antenna
is
recommended.
Disconnect
the
antenna
if
an
FM
outdoor
antenna
is
installed.
FM
outdoor
antenna
(not
included)
The
outdoor
antenna
should
be
used
when
using
the
main
unit
in
mountainous
areas
or
in
spaces
enclosed
by
reinforced
concrete
where
the
FM
indoor
antenna
(included)
does
not
provide
satisfac¬
tory
reception.
An
outdoor
antenna
should
be
installed
by
a
qualified
technician
only.
FM
outdoor
antenna
(not
included)
H
How
to
use
the
antenna
plug
(included)
Two
types
of
wire
are
most
commonly
used
for
connection
from
the
antenna:
300-ohms
parallel
feeder
wire
or
75-ohms
coaxial
cable.
For
best
resistance
to
outside
interference,
the
use
of
75-ohms
coaxial
cable
is
suggested.
